What happened Jabbas pet?

After a failed negotiation Jedi Knight Luke Skywalker killed Jabba’s pet rancor Pateesa. He accompanied his boss and his guests on the ill-fated Khetanna to the Great Pit of Carkoon, where Jabba planned to execute some of the Rebels.

Is salacious B Crumb dead?

Death. Salacious Crumb was shocked away from C-3PO by R2-D2 just before the destruction of Jabba’s sail barge, while ripping out Threepio’s photoreceptors. He died in the following explosion.

What are Jabba’s guards called?

Burly, pig-like brutes who favored axes and other primitive weapons, Gamorreans were often used as muscle by Hutts and other underworld kingpins. Jabba the Hutt employed a gang of intimidating Gamorreans to guard his palace on Tatooine.

Who created Salacious Crumb?

Tony McVey
Tony McVey, the sculptor who designed and fabricated Salacious B. Crumb — including a new 1:1 replica statue from Regal Robot — and many other denizens of the galaxy far, far away, intended to have a career as a graphic designer.

Who is Jabba the Hutt’s son?

Rotta the Huttlet
Rotta the Huttlet. Heir apparent to the Hutt empire, Jabba’s infant son was barely old enough to slither before his conniving and power-hungry great-uncle, Ziro, already had him marked for death at the time of the Clone Wars.

Who voices salacious BMB?

Mark Dodson
Mark Dodson is an American actor who voiced Salacious Crumb in Star Wars: Episode VI Return of the Jedi, and provided various voices for Ewoks: The Battle for Endor and Star Wars: Episode VII The Force Awakens. He is best known as the voice of the eponymous creatures in Gremlins and Gremlins 2: The New Batch.

What was the name of Jabba the Hutt’s dog?

Buboicullaar, or “Bubo” for short, was another one of Jabba’s beloved pets kept in the palace. Bubo was a frog-dog, short and squat with only two arm-like limbs. The creature was seen as rather unintelligent, but Jabba enjoyed keeping him around. Bubo has even appeared in some Star Wars graphic novels.

How many Star Wars movies does Jabba the Hutt appear in?

Jabba the Hutt appears in three of the nine live-action Star Wars films ( The Phantom Menace, the Special Edition of A New Hope and Return of the Jedi) and The Clone Wars.

How did b crumb get to be on Jabba the Hutt?

Crumb’s association with Jabba began when the thief stowed away on the Hutt’s starship, and was found and captured by the Twi’lek Bib Fortuna. Jabba struck up a unique deal with the monkey-lizard: If Crumb could amuse Jabba at least once a day, he would be allowed to eat and drink as much as he pleased; if he failed, however, he would be slain.

Who are the gammoreans in Jabba the Hutt?

The Gammoreans hail from planet Gamorr, and are a race of green-skinned, pig-like creatures with large snouts and upturned tusks. They are large and stout, making formidable guards employed by Jabba the Hutt to protect his palace.
